Abstract
Abstract The Lewis acid behaviour of triphenyltin azide has been examined through interaction with various N- and O-donor ligands. The newly synthesised compounds have been characterised and their structure established on the basis of elemental analyses, molar conductance, molecular weight, IR, UV, 1H NMR and 13C NMR spectral studies. The thermal stability of the compounds has been examined by TGA.
